Decoding Hot and Cold Streaks: A Data-Driven Phenomenon

Slot machines, whether physical or digital, are governed primarily by Random Number Generators (RNGs), which produce sequences of numbers determining the outcome of each spin. Despite their intrinsic randomness, players often perceive patterns such as consecutive wins (hot streaks) or losses (cold streaks). These phenomena are statistically inevitable due to volume; however, distinguishing genuine pattern from chance requires meticulous data analysis.
